찾다

 >  Q&A  >  본문

CSS가 없는 일반 HTML: Colspan이 th/td에서 제대로 작동하지 않고 모든 행에서 일관됩니다.

colspan가 작동하지 않는 이유를 모르겠습니다. CSS 솔루션이 있는데 왜 이것이 작동하지 않는지 혼란스럽습니다. 첫 번째 열의 너비는 다른 열의 1/3이어야 하며, 첫 번째 열과 td는 colspan="1"이고 다른 모든 열은 colspan="3"입니다.

이 앱은 순위표용이므로 첫 번째 열에는 순위 번호(1, 2, 3...)가 포함되며 후속 열보다 훨씬 좁아야 합니다.

물론 class="colspan-3"class="colspan-1" 以及 css colspan-1{width:4.5%} colspan-3{width:13.5%} 来解决이나 다른 수학적 결과를 사용할 수 있습니다...하지만 무슨 일이 일어나고 있는지 알고 싶습니다.

이 질문이 미래에 누군가에게 도움이 될 것이라고 생각해서 세부 사항을 추가합니다:

당시에는 각 열의 너비를 다른 열에 상대적으로 설정함으로써 상대 단위로 colspan을 사용할 수 있다고 생각했습니다. 내가 겪고 있는 문제는 각 열의 단위가 정확히 동일하다는 것입니다. 이는 열의 개별 셀에서만 작동하며 본질적으로 Microsoft Excel의 "병합" 기능과 유사합니다.

으아아아

P粉899950720P粉899950720232일 전430

모든 응답(1)나는 대답할 것이다

  • P粉011360903

    P粉0113609032024-04-01 10:46:55

    @Ouroborus에게 감사드립니다. 제가 미쳤다고 생각했습니다. 하지만 거의 10년 동안 매일 HTML을 사용한 후에도 아직 배워야 할 것이 분명히 남아 있습니다.

    colspan은 여기에 정의된 대로 열의 모든 셀이 동일한 범위의 열 수로 설정된 경우 작동하지 않습니다. https://developer.mozilla.org/en-US/docs/Web/HTML /Element/td

    제 오해를 찾아주신 Ouroborus에게 다시 한 번 감사드립니다!

    회신하다
    0
  • 취소회신하다